- Wool: Wool is a classic for a reason. It's warm, durable, and naturally water-resistant. Wool coats are perfect for those colder months and add a touch of sophistication to any outfit. However, wool can require a bit more care, like dry cleaning.
- Cotton: Cotton is your go-to for a more casual and breathable option. Cotton coats are ideal for spring and fall, offering comfort and versatility. They're also relatively easy to care for, often machine washable.
- Canvas: Canvas is tough! It's super durable and rugged, making it a great choice for outdoor adventures. Canvas coats often have a workwear-inspired aesthetic, giving off a cool, utilitarian vibe.
- Polyester/Synthetic blends: These materials are often more affordable and provide good weather resistance. They are also easier to care for than natural materials. But, be careful about the breathability. It is something to take into account before buying.
- Tailored fit: A tailored fit is designed to hug your body, creating a more polished and streamlined look. This is perfect for when you want to look sharp and put-together, even in a casual coat.
- Regular fit: Regular fit coats offer a comfortable balance. They're not too tight or too loose, allowing for easy layering without sacrificing style.
- Relaxed fit: A relaxed fit is all about comfort and a laid-back vibe. These coats offer plenty of room to move around, making them ideal for casual outings or layering over bulkier sweaters.
- Pockets: Pockets are practical and stylish. Look for well-placed pockets that are functional and add to the coat's overall design. Think about the type of pockets you want: patch pockets, flap pockets, or welt pockets.
- Buttons/Zippers: The closure method impacts the look and functionality of the coat. Buttons offer a classic, refined look, while zippers can be more modern and streamlined. Choose what aligns with your personal style and needs.
- Collar: The collar frames your face and sets the tone for the coat. A classic notched lapel is versatile, while a stand-up collar offers a more casual and sporty feel. Consider the collar style that complements your face shape and overall look.
- Lining: A good lining can enhance both comfort and durability. Consider the material of the lining: It can be as important as the outer fabric, especially in colder climates.

The Classic Pea Coat
Let's start with a classic: the pea coat. This iconic coat, originally worn by sailors, has become a wardrobe staple. Typically made of thick wool, the pea coat features a double-breasted design, wide lapels, and distinctive buttons. It's warm, stylish, and incredibly versatile. The great thing about a pea coat is that it is timeless! You can wear it with almost anything. Dress it up with a button-down shirt and chinos for a more polished look, or go casual with jeans and a sweater. The versatility of the pea coat makes it a must-have.
The Versatile Field Jacket
The field jacket is another fantastic option. Inspired by military apparel, this jacket typically features multiple pockets, a practical design, and a rugged aesthetic. It's usually made from durable materials like cotton or canvas, making it great for everyday wear. The field jacket is perfect for a more casual, outdoorsy vibe. Pair it with a t-shirt and jeans for a classic look, or layer it over a flannel shirt for extra warmth. The field jacket is all about functionality and effortless style.
The Stylish Parka
For colder weather, a parka is your best friend. This coat is designed to provide maximum warmth and protection from the elements. Parkas typically have a hood, often with a fur trim, and are made from water-resistant materials. This coat will keep you warm, while still keeping you stylish. The parka is great for those harsh winter days. Pair it with warm layers underneath, like a sweater and thermal underwear, and complete the look with boots and a beanie.
The Trendy Bomber Jacket
If you want something more modern, consider a bomber jacket. This sporty jacket, with its short, streamlined design, has become a fashion favorite. Bomber jackets are often made from nylon, leather, or other materials and come in a variety of colors and styles. They are great for adding a touch of urban cool to your outfits. Pair a bomber jacket with jeans and sneakers for a casual look, or dress it up with a button-down shirt and chinos.
The Sophisticated Trench Coat
Last, but not least, is the trench coat. This classic coat, originally designed for military use, is now a symbol of sophistication and style. Trench coats typically feature a double-breasted design, a belt, and a knee-length cut. Made from water-resistant materials, they're perfect for rainy days. It is great for a more polished look. Wear a trench coat over a suit for a sophisticated vibe, or dress it down with a sweater and jeans.

Considering Your Climate and Weather Conditions
Climate is a huge factor! If you live in a cold climate, you'll need a coat that provides warmth and protection from the elements. A parka or a wool coat is a great choice. If you live in a milder climate, you can opt for a lighter coat, such as a field jacket or a cotton jacket. Think about rain. If your area is rainy, look for a coat made from water-resistant materials. The weather will tell you what style to look for.
